Monday 24th ~ Sunday 30th of September at the Guangzhou Tianhe Sports Centre, China
The 4th Ranking Championship this week with Luca Brecel defending the title he won last year in beating Shaun Murphy 10-5 in the final.
Not many shocks in Preston with Martin Gould and Ricky Walden losing is the biggest shock so that means most of the big hitters still in with Ronnie O'Sullivan missing yet again.
With Kyren Wilson, Neil Robertson and World Champion Mark J Williams alredy picked up ranking events already this season can they pick up another this week.
Or will Mark Selby, John Higgins, Ding Junhui and Judd Trump join the party?
